Jordan Wilby

Jordan’s appreciation of music led him to venture out of his hometown in Santa Barbara to Los Angeles. In 2002, he enrolled in the Recording Arts program at The Los Angeles Recording School, a division of The L.A. Film School, and completed his studies in 2004. A stickler for experiential learning, Wilby secured an internship shortly thereafter with Hammerhead Sound. Jordan’s growing love for audio postproduction led him to work on projects that are now well-known and adored by audiences worldwide. Chances are, if you are a film or television lover, you have heard sounds designed and edited by Jordan Wilby.

“You have an idea in your head and how you want the scene to be. The challenge is really how do I put what’s in my head into the session and deliver it to the mixer.”

Jordan’s work appears in popular shows like Stranger Things, The Twilight Zone, The Vampire Diaries, Watchmen (2019) — where he served as sound effects editor for all nine episodes — Mare of Easttown (2021) — where he is credited as sound effects editor for all seven episodes — and Bosch (2019–2021) — where he worked as sound effects editor on eight episodes. His dedication to post‑production sound landed him multiple Primetime Emmy nominations and two Primetime Emmy wins: Outstanding Sound Editing for Stranger Things Seasons 1 and 2. He also earned an Emmy for Watchmen in 2020 for Outstanding Sound Editing for a Limited Series, shared with the Watchmen sound team. Before Stranger Things, Jordan worked on a multitude of Marvel productions including The Punisher, Jessica Jones and Daredevil.
